void XMLHttpRequest::onReplyFinished() {
    const QString redirect = QString::fromUtf8(m_reply->rawHeader("Location"));
    
    if (!redirect.isEmpty()) {
        Logger::log("XMLHttpRequest::onReplyFinished(): Redirect: " + redirect);
        
        if (m_redirects < MAX_REDIRECTS) {
            QUrl url(redirect);
            
            if (url.scheme().isEmpty()) {
                url.setScheme(m_reply->url().scheme());
            }
            
            if (url.authority().isEmpty()) {
                url.setAuthority(m_reply->url().authority());
            }
            
            m_reply->deleteLater();
            m_reply = 0;
            followRedirect(url);
            return;
        }
    }
    
    if (m_reply->bytesAvailable() > 0) {
        m_response += m_reply->readAll();
    }
    
    setStatus(m_reply->attribute(QNetworkRequest::HttpStatusCodeAttribute).toInt());
    setStatusText(m_reply->attribute(QNetworkRequest::HttpReasonPhraseAttribute).toString());
    setReadyState(DONE);
    m_reply->deleteLater();
    m_reply = 0;
}

void Rss::parseTracks(QNetworkReply *reply) {
    if (!reply) {
        std::cout << qPrintable(QString("{\"error\": \"%1\"}").arg(tr("Network error")));
        QCoreApplication::exit(1);
        return;
    }
    
    if (reply->error() != QNetworkReply::NoError) {
        reply->deleteLater();
        std::cout << qPrintable(QString("{\"error\": \"%1: %2\"}").arg(tr("Network error")).arg(reply->errorString()));
        QCoreApplication::exit(1);
        return;
    }
    
    QVariant redirect = reply->attribute(QNetworkRequest::RedirectionTargetAttribute);
    
    if (!redirect.isNull()) {
        reply->deleteLater();
        
        if (m_redirects < MAX_REDIRECTS) {
            followRedirect(redirect.toString());
        }
        else {
            std::cout << qPrintable(QString("{\"error\": \"%1: %2\"}").arg(tr("Network error"))
                                                                .arg(tr("Maximum redirects reached")));
            QCoreApplication::exit(1);
        }
        
        return;
    }
    
    QDomDocument doc;    
    
    if (!doc.setContent(reply->readAll(), true)) {
        reply->deleteLater();
        std::cout << qPrintable(QString("{\"error\": \"%1\"}").arg(tr("Unable to parse XML")));
        QCoreApplication::exit(1);
        return;
    }
    
    QDomElement docElem = doc.documentElement();
    QDomNodeList items = docElem.elementsByTagName("item");
    QDomNode channelElem = docElem.firstChildElement("channel");
    QString thumbnailUrl = channelElem.firstChildElement("image").attribute("href");
    QString genre = channelElem.firstChildElement("category").attribute("text");
    
    for (int i = 0; i < items.size(); i++) {
        QDomElement item = items.at(i).toElement();
        QDateTime dt = QDateTime::fromString(item.firstChildElement("pubDate").text().section(' ', 0, -2),
                                               "ddd, dd MMM yyyy hh:mm:ss");
        QString streamUrl = item.firstChildElement("enclosure").attribute("url");
        
        QVariantMap result;
        result["_dt"] = dt;
        result["artist"] = item.firstChildElement("author").text();
        result["date"] = dt.toString("dd MMM yyyy");
        result["description"] = item.firstChildElement("description").text();
        result["duration"] = item.firstChildElement("duration").text();
        result["format"] = streamUrl.mid(streamUrl.lastIndexOf('.') + 1).toUpper();
        result["genre"] = genre;
        result["id"] = reply->url();
        result["largeThumbnailUrl"] = thumbnailUrl;
        result["streamUrl"] = streamUrl;
        result["thumbnailUrl"] = thumbnailUrl;
        result["title"] = item.firstChildElement("title").text();
        result["url"] = item.firstChildElement("link").text();
        m_results << result;
    }
    
    reply->deleteLater();
    
    if (m_urls.isEmpty()) {
        printResult();
    }
    else {
        listTracks(m_urls.takeFirst());
    }
}

void RequestPrivate::_q_onReplyFinished() {
    if (!reply) {
        return;
    }
    
    Q_Q(Request);
    
    if (redirects < MAX_REDIRECTS) {
        QUrl redirect = reply->attribute(QNetworkRequest::RedirectionTargetAttribute).toUrl();
    
        if (redirect.isEmpty()) {
            redirect = reply->header(QNetworkRequest::LocationHeader).toUrl();
        }
    
        if (!redirect.isEmpty()) {
            reply->deleteLater();
            reply = 0;
            followRedirect(redirect);
            return;
        }
    }
    
    bool ok = true;
    const QString response = QString::fromUtf8(reply->readAll());
    setResult(response.isEmpty() ? response : QtJson::Json::parse(response, ok));
    
    const QNetworkReply::NetworkError e = reply->error();
    const QString es = reply->errorString();
    reply->deleteLater();
    reply = 0;
    
    switch (e) {
    case QNetworkReply::NoError:
        break;
    case QNetworkReply::OperationCanceledError:
        setStatus(Request::Canceled);
        setError(Request::NoError);
        setErrorString(QString());
        emit q->finished();
        return;
    case QNetworkReply::AuthenticationRequiredError:
        if (refreshToken.isEmpty()) {
            setStatus(Request::Failed);
            setError(Request::Error(e));
            setErrorString(es);
            emit q->finished();
        }
        else {
            refreshAccessToken();
        }
        
        return;
    default:
        setStatus(Request::Failed);
        setError(Request::Error(e));
        setErrorString(es);
        emit q->finished();
        return;
    }
    
    if (ok) {
        setStatus(Request::Ready);
        setError(Request::NoError);
        setErrorString(QString());
    }
    else {
        setStatus(Request::Failed);
        setError(Request::ParseError);
        setErrorString(Request::tr("Unable to parse response"));
    }
        
    emit q->finished();
}
